Foot Anatomy Terms . The foot is subdivided into the rearfoot, midfoot, and forefoot. Upper ankle joint (tibiotarsal), talocalcaneonavicular, and subtalar joints. The ankle joint, also known as the talocrural joint, allows dorsiflexion and plantar flexion of the foot. These bones give structure to the foot and allow for all foot movements like flexing.
